Quarterback Questions Aren’t Enough to Derail the Buckeyes
Ohio State went with quality over quantity when working the transfer portal.
Former Alabama safety Caleb Downs is the top-rated transfer in the 247sports.com database with Alabama quarterback Julian Sayin, Ole Miss running back Quinshon Judkins, and Kansas State quarterback Will Howard as other top incoming transfers.
The Buckeyes only signed seven transfers but three of them were in the top 10 in the transfer rankings. They could figure prominently in the 2024 Ohio State Buckeyes stats.
With last year’s starting quarterback Kyle McCord now at Syracuse, Sayin and Howard are fighting it out with 2023 backup Devin Brown for the starting job.
The group of receivers will look much different with All-American Marvin Harrison Jr. and tight end Cade Stover now in the NFL while Julian Fleming transferred to Penn State. Emeka Egbuka figures to put up huge numbers as he did two seasons ago.
With Judkins joining TreVeyon Henderson, the Buckeyes could have the top 1-2 running back tandem in the country. Another key addition was former Oregon and UCLA head coach Chip Kelly being brought in as the offensive coordinator.

Conference Odds: Can the Buckeyes Tame the Wolverines?
Ohio State has been undefeated heading into the regular-season finale against Michigan in each of the last two seasons only to lose both games. The 2021 and 2022 defeats at the hands of the Wolverines were pretty humbling but the Buckeyes were right there with Michigan in last year’s game.
Ohio State outgained Michigan in the 2023 game but a pair of turnovers were the difference as Michigan came away with a six-point win as a three-point favorite.
This year’s game is at Ohio State and with the pressure on head coach Ryan Day to end a three-game losing streak to the Wolverines, this feels like a must-win game for Ohio State.
The college football betting lines list Ohio State as an underdog against Big Ten newcomer Oregon while the Buckeyes look to beat Penn State for the eighth time in a row. Four of those games were decided by single digits so this could be a dangerous matchup for Ohio State with Penn State covering in four of the last five home games against the Buckeyes.
Regular Season Wins: Can the Buckeyes Top 10.5 Wins?
When looking at the 2024 Ohio State Buckeyes stats, there is little margin for error for Ohio State to go over 10½ wins during the regular season.
Ohio State can lose one game and still finish over that total. The Oregon, Penn State, and Michigan games look like the only ones where the Buckeyes could be in danger of losing.
In a perfect world. Ohio State will be 11-0 going into the Michigan game and that will relieve the stress from those who went with the Buckeyes to go over 10½ wins this season.
A quick look back at NCAAF scores will show that Ohio State has won 11 of the last 12 games against Penn State. The Buckeyes haven’t lost to Michigan State since 2016, are 12-2 over the last 14 meetings with Iowa, have won seven games in a row versus Nebraska, are on a 10-game winning streak against Northwestern and 21 of the last 24 wins against Indiana have come by double digits.
